Why Induction Sealers Are Critical for Food Safety

When it comes to food production, safety is paramount. Faulty packaging that allows contamination or spoilage can harm consumers, erode trust, and lead to costly recalls. One technology that helps packagers ensure food safety and quality is induction sealing. For threaded capped containers and bottles, induction sealers create a hermetic barrier that ensures food remains…
